Job description

Job Summary

The position is described below. Process, monitor, research, mitigate risks, and preserve the data integrity of the operational aspect and the credit documentation of the supported commercial lending portfolios by providing an exceptional level of quality, client service and efficiency.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  1. Receive workflow items, retrieve account information, and execute requests.
  2. Exceed consistently production and quality defined goals.
  3. Demonstrate a proficient knowledge of systems and processes while recognizing gaps, and maintaining a growth mindset.
  4. Assist with researching complex issues and provide innovative solutions.
  5. Resolve escalated issues.
  6. Develop positive communication and relationships with peers, partners, and external clients and support initiatives and other duties as assigned.
  7. Motivate, train, counsel, and encourage lower level teammate's consistency of operations.
  8. Recognize downstream implication of work performed and the impact on the success of the company.
Qualifications

Regular or Temporary: Regular Language Fluency: English (Required) Work Shift: 1st shift (United States of America)

Required Qualifications:

  • Associate's Degree or work related experience, or equivalent education and related training
  • Three years of banking or financial services experience, preferably in a high paced, high volume environment
  • Detail oriented and proficient in basic computer applications such as Microsoft Office software products
  • Knowledge of regulatory, external, and internal compliance requirements and guidelines
  • Must be able to communicate effectively across multiple levels of lending personnel, including strong written and verbal communications
  • Strong time management, problem solving, analytical and organizational skills
  • Aptitude to read and interpret complex loan documents and loan structures
  • Sound decision making skills that demonstrate flexibility, resourcefulness and the ability to work independently
  • Demonstrates ability to work in an area governed by production standards, heavy workloads and critical deadlines

Preferred Qualifications:

  • A Bachelor's Degree
  • Five years of previous banking or financial services experience
